Ticket: Vault lockout blocking ORM refactor branch — heads-up, Marisel. The Copperfen secrets vault locked itself mid-rotation, so the migration scripts for the legacy Tanglewood ORM refactor can't fetch staging credentials. Merge is otherwise green; tests pass against the local fixture DB. I'd hold the release train until we unseal, since the schema bump needs live creds. Once you're ready, unseal the vault using the recovery passphrase directly below.

unlock words, hahip-baduf: holwyn-istath-julvan

## Pool Car Key Cabinet

The key cabinet for the Ostreval pool cars is mounted behind the reception desk in the Larkspan Building lobby. Reception staff issue keys only against a completed booking in the vehicle log; record mileage on return. Keys must be back in the cabinet by end of shift — never left on the desk. The cabinet lock opens with the code below.

turnstile pass: bdg-FVNQRS-72965873

### Capacity note: Pinchek baseline file

Heads up — the Pinchek static-analysis baseline for the monorepo has grown to about 40k suppressed findings, and every CI run loads the whole thing into memory. At current commit volume we'll blow past the analyzer's comfortable working set sometime next quarter. Short term we're capping baseline size and shard count, and the nightly re-baseline job gets a hard timeout. If you get paged on analyzer OOMs, these are the knobs that matter.

tuning table, yajog-yahof:
BUDGETS = {
    "lamvan": 303,
    "wenox": 460,
    "fenvan": 525,
}

# Inkmill Environments

Inkmill is Quartzbay's markdown rendering pipeline, converting authored documents into sanitized HTML for the docs portal. We run three environments: dev, staging, and prod. Each environment has its own renderer pool, cache tier, and plugin allowlist, so never assume parity between them. Staging mirrors prod's sanitizer rules but uses a smaller cache. Before deploying, verify your target environment against the values below. The current staging configuration is as follows.

service settings:
[casax]
port = 6379
team = rusir
host = casax.zemvarhq.corp
region = outer-4
access_code = ac_9808ce
timeout_ms = 1500